About Kevin Clarkson

 
 
  • Biography

    My work is landscape and representational in the English painting tradition. Themes include marine coastal scenes, landscapes, aviation and portraiture. I particularly enjoy capturing the elemental forces of land, sea, and sky.

    I have a schoolboy enthusiasm for machines, which fly or float and my paintings usually begin with rigorous historical research.

    

I am Chairman of the Thames Maritime Artists Group, formerly Chairman of the National Maritime Museum Art Club and the Old Royal Naval College Art Club. My work was included in the 2019 Royal Society of Marine Artists annual exhibition at The Mall Galleries in London and have in the past featured as the Online Gallery ‘Artist of the Month’  in The Artist Magazine. I have work in the permanent collection of the Guildhall Museum, Eastgate House Rochester and Upnor Castle in Kent and in collections worldwide.

    

I also demonstrate painting techniques with acrylics and watercolours to several arts clubs and undertake private commissions.
